The commissioning ceremony is a formal event where the ship is officially put into service. It's not just a paperwork thing; it's a significant milestone that signifies the ship's readiness to undertake its duties. During the ceremony, the ship's commissioning pennant is hoisted, and the commanding officer reads the commissioning warrant. This is followed by the crew taking the oath of service. Family, friends, dignitaries and naval personnel attend these ceremonies. **The commissioning of a ship is a complex process**, involving thorough inspections, training, and the final handover from the builders to the Navy. The crew spends months preparing, learning every nook and cranny of their new vessel and becoming experts at using the ship's systems and armaments. It's a time of immense pride and excitement for everyone involved. After commissioning, the ship begins its operational life, participating in exercises, patrols, and other missions to protect our nation's interests. The commissioning process ensures that a ship is fully prepared and capable of performing its intended role in the Indian Navy. This includes rigorous testing of all systems, thorough training of the crew, and the establishment of essential support networks. This is not a fast process, but a detailed one. Before commissioning, there are several preliminary steps that must be completed. These steps include the ship's construction, trials, and inspections. The crew will have to undergo comprehensive training and the ship undergoes a battery of tests to confirm all operational systems are running properly. **The commissioning process is a critical part of a ship's life cycle**, and it ensures that the ship is ready to serve the nation.
